Toronto Fashion Week: DAY TWO

Day TWO was a solid day of shows that started on a high note with Laura Siegel’s tribal infused collection. Klaxon Howl remained true to his aesthetic while David Dixon made a bold statement for women by calling bullshit to women still being a minority. After winning last year’s Mercedes Benz Start Up program DUY wowed on the runway with a 27 piece collection. Line Knitwear fused elements of their knitwear with leather for their fall collection and Sid Neigum closed out the day beautifull!
